| Definitely agree that the lyrics are the weakest aspect of the album. There is absolutely nothing original, inventive, or creative about the lyrics at all on this album. Jahred has gotten to the point where he just recycles lyrics from song to song, and not even good ones, and it gets extremely repetitive, not only hearing things you just heard in previous songs, but on other albums several times already. He used to be such a good lyricist. I don't know what the fuck happened. They're lucky the songwriting is so tight this time around or this could've been a disaster. | |

| what a load of bullshit i was checking billboard to see how truth rising did, here are the numbers: Billboard 200: 98 Rock Albums: 26 Independent Albums: 13 Alternative Albums: 14 Hard Rock Albums: 7 How come Truth Rising didn't do better than N. W. O.????? I don't get it | |
